The story of Malvika becoming a heroine is very interesting. In a conversation with 'Amar Ujala', Malavika says, "I was in college those days and I did not know which direction I have to go in. It was decided that I didn't want to do science or commerce, whatever I wanted to do, I had to do it in arts. And, this incident happened during those days. We watch malayalam movies a lot at home and I have been a big fan of Mammootty sir. He is a big superstar. We had gone to watch the shooting of one of his advertisement films. He saw me there and called me to him."

Actor mammootty not only called Malvika to meet him but also took her audition right there. Malvika tells this with great enthusiasm, "Yes, he kept talking to me for a long time and also took me here and there and shot it. Later he sent all this to the film director. I understood later that the first audition of my career was recorded by Mammootty sirThink, how big a thing this is for any artist. After this audition, I got my first film with his son Dulquer Salman."

Malvika, who worked with superstar Rajinikanth in the film 'Petta', never forgets the day when they first met. Malvika says, "I first met him in Mussoorie. I was there for the shooting of the film 'Petta'. A day before starting the shooting, I went to meet everyone at the location. I waited for him and after a while, I got a call. Meeting him was a memorable moment. His aura is so strong that it pulls you towards him. He is such a big star but his humility is worth learning. He made me feel very comfortable. The time I spent with him will remain memorable for the rest of my life.”
